A field experiment was conducted in the Horticulture farm of Sher-e-Bangla Agricultural University, Dhaka during the period from October 2019 to April 2020 to evaluate the effect of foliar application of supplement copper-based zinc nano fertilizer on lisianthus. Copper-based zinc nano fertilizer application with different concentrations in: N0 (Control; No nano fertilizer application), N1 (1ml/L), N2 (2ml/L) were used in this experiment arranged in Randomized Complete Block Design with three replications. Data on different physiological growth and flower yield attributes parameters were collected in which all the treatments showed significant variations. 2ml/L copper-based zinc nano fertilizer treated plants showed the highest plant height (78.8 cm), number of leaves (104.3), SPAD value (56.7), stem diameter (5.4 mm), stem length (56.8cm) which influence the growth characteristics of the plant along with promoting flowering almost 10 days earlier compared to control. In view of overall performance, 2ml/L foliar application of copper-based zinc nano fertilizer (N2) on lisianthus significantly increases flower yield and vase life of the flower.
